Today's Perth Newspaper, 'The Sunday Times', a rather small article (on page 16 in the 'late edition').....
States that "The FED govt is not supporting a plan to relocate JT .....
"The Commonwealth is in no way supporting any move to close Jandakot at this time", is the quote from the Deputy Sec. of the DOTARS dept.
Better yet, Senator Bill Heffernan is quoted as saying that the plan was a sharp opportunity for a developer to convert the area into building blocks
"and get millions of dollars in a bank account somewhere and bugger the inconvenience to everyone else".
